Hi everybody! I am the owner/M.D. of a cotton spinning unit. I am an electronics/software person by education and training. I had to take charge of this unit due to some family problems.
I have picked up a good bit of the technical part and I have succeeded in making the unit debt free. But, now,when it comes to going to the next level, I am finding it tough. Especially, motivating/leading employees whose educational levels are quite low is a real challenge. The nature of the jobs (repetitive, all three shifts and very little prospects of promotion rank-wise) makes the job even harder.
May I have some ideas/tips/techniques about how to go about the job. My aim is to create a world class organization but how can I get my people to understand this?
